Botanical Name: Hyssopus Officinalis

Origin: Germany

Common Name: Hyssop Herb Powder

English Name: Hyssop Powder

French Name: Poudre d’Hysope

Also Known As: Dried Hyssop Powder, Hyssop Leaf Powder, Hyssop Herb Powder, Hyssopus Powder

Part Used: Aerial parts (leaves and stems) of Hyssopus officinalis

Description: Hyssop is a perennial herb native to the Mediterranean region and widely cultivated in temperate areas. It typically grows 30–60cm tall with upright, woody stems and narrow, lance-shaped, dark green leaves. During the flowering season, it produces small tubular flowers in shades of blue to violet, forming clusters along the upper stems. The aerial parts are harvested at full growth to retain natural colour, texture, and identifiable botanical characteristics.

The leaves are firm but soft to the touch, growing opposite along slender, slightly woody stems. The stems are flexible at the tips and bushy at maturity, giving the plant a dense, structured appearance. Harvesting occurs during peak flowering to capture both leaves and tender stems. After drying, the material maintains its natural colour and texture, making it suitable for milling into a fine powder while retaining its botanical character.

After harvesting, the aerial parts are cleaned to remove dirt, debris, and excess stalks. The material is then dried using controlled low-temperature methods and milled into a uniform, fine powder. Any coarse fragments are removed during sieving to ensure a clean, free flowing powdered herb suitable for blending, storage, and various applications.
